You can just install a chrome 'beauty cap' over the end of your shifter shaft and bolt the inner lever to a tie down bracket on the motor/trans case ...

It is the same solution that many adopt when switching to forward controls ... avoids the necessity of having to remove the primary cases ...

The footboard kit should be an easy half-hour or so install if you are not doing anything with the mid-control shift lever ...
